Factors Affecting Cost

  • Property Size: Larger properties may require more extensive drainage systems, increasing overall costs.
  • Soil Type: Certain soil types, such as clay, may demand more complex solutions, affecting expenses.
  • Slope and Terrain: Steeper slopes and uneven terrain can complicate installation, leading to higher costs.
  • Drainage System Type: Choices range from French drains to surface drains, each with different cost implications.
  • Permit Requirements: Local regulations may necessitate permits, adding to the overall expense.
  • Labor Costs: Labor rates in Cave Creek, AZ, can vary, influencing the total project cost.
  • Material Quality: Higher quality materials, while more durable, will also be more expensive.

Common Tasks and Costs

Task Average Cost
Site Assessment and Planning $300 - $500
French Drain Installation $20 - $30 per foot
Surface Drain Installation $15 - $25 per foot
Grading and Sloping $1,000 - $3,000
Catch Basin Installation $200 - $400 each
Downspout Extensions $100 - $300 each
Dry Well Installation $1,500 - $3,000
Excavation and Trenching $50 - $100 per hour
Permit Fees $100 - $500
